Quote:
Originally Posted by sickkittens
What's best for chest? Bench press?

That also depends on if you wanna bulk up or work every angle of the chest. For bulking up, i would just stick to the bench press. start with a weight you can do 5-10 presses with. Do like 5 sets. Once you feel like you can do more then 10 with the weight you started with, push up the weights till your doing only 5-10 max. Works well for me.

You can also try using two dumbells (like 20 LB each to start with) and doing butterflys onthe incline bench, a flat bench and a declined bench. That shit works almost every lil piece of your chest.

First question I would get answered is what type body do you have Mesomorph,ectomorph etc...Some people are not capable of putting on more than a certain amount of size so lifting heavy will not do much except injure you. Talk to a trainer at the gym they can help you figure this out.

In the short run if you are looking for muscle strength for baseball I would do 8-10 reps at a medium weight for 3 days (break your routine into chest/tris, back/bis, legs and shoulders), taking one day off and then doing 3 days of light wieghts 12-15 reps. I play a lot of hockey and this gives me a good strength/endurance mix. I would also suggest at least 20 minutes of cardio (running or elliptical) a day to get your body in shape...and avoid slurpies
